This pin is configured to operate as an LED when
the LED 4 Enable bit in the LED Configuration
Register (LED_CFG) is set. The buffer type
depends on the setting of the LED Function 1-0
(LED_FUN[1:0]) field in the LED Configuration
Register (LED_CFG) and is configured to be either
an push-pull or open-drain/open-source output.
When selected as an open-drain/open-source
output, the polarity of this pin depends up the
MNGT1_LED4P strap value sampled at reset.
IS/O12/
OD12
(PU)
This pin is configured to operate as a GPIO when
the LED 4 Enable bit of the LED Configuration
Register (LED_CFG) is clear. The pin is fully
programmable as either a push-pull output, an
open-drain output, or a Schmitt-triggered input by
writing the General Purpose I/O Configuration
Register (GPIO_CFG) and the General Purpose
I/O Data & Direction Register (GPIO_DATA_DIR).
IS
(PU)
This strap configures the Serial Management
Mode, as well as the polarity of the LED 4 pin when
it is an open-drain or open-source output. See
Note 3.6.
If the strap value is 0:
The LED is set as active high, since it is assumed
that a LED to ground is used as the pull-down.
If the strap value is 1:
The LED is set as active low, since it is assumed
that a LED to VDD is used as the pull-up.
